NOTE: instead of using rust's
f64::from_str, I used thelexicalcrate, whose flexibility more closely matches Python's float parsing (e.g. it correctly supports all the variations in the test case of this PR, while the former does not). As a nice bonus, it's 4000x faster. You can read more about it here.
